Located in the Bellevue Public Schools at 2202 Washington St in Bellevue, NE, Bellevue Mission Middle School serves grades 7-8 and has an enrollment of roughly 401 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Bellevue
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bellevue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bellevue ranges from $595 to $2,496 with an average monthly rent of $1,171.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bellevue c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bellevue range from $700 to $2,836.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,449.
How expensive are Bellevue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 37 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bellevue on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,346 to $3,858 - averaging $1,692 for the location.
